26,687,590 is an even composite number composed of six prime numbers multiplied together.
26687590 is an even composite number. It is composed of six dist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of sixty-four divisors.
Prime factorization of 26687590:
2 × 5 × 19 × 23 × 31 × 197

- Sum of all divisors σ(n): 54743040
- Sum of proper divisors (its aliquot sum) s(n): 28055450
- 26687590 is an abundant number, because the sum of its proper divisors (28055450) is greater than itself. Its abundance is 1367860
